ホームページ > 記事 > PHPフレームワーク > Thinkphp5 統合 Grid++ レポートの詳細説明
thinkphp のチュートリアル コラムでは、Thinkphp5 がグリッド レポートをどのように統合するかを紹介します。困っている友人の役に立てば幸いです。
phpstudy、thinkphp5、grid Report6
1. インポート ファイル
<script type="text/javascript" src="__STATIC__/admin/js/GRInstall.js" ></script> <script type="text/javascript" src="__STATIC__/admin/js/GRUtility.js" ></script> <script type="text/javascript" src="__STATIC__/admin/js/CreateControl.js" ></script>これら 3 つは、グリッド Web プラグインで使用される JS です。 , これら 3 つのファイルを public/admin/js ディレクトリに配置しましたので... (実際には、どこに配置してもパスを導入するだけです) 2. グリッドでレポートを作成します## ####操作手順に従ってください######3. Web ページにデザイナー プラグインを挿入します###
<script type="text/javascript"> //用查询显示控件展现报表,从URL“../grf/1a.grf”获取报表模板定义,从URL“../data/DataCenter.php?data=Customer”获取XML形式的报表数据, CreateDisplayViewerEx("100%", "100%", "__STATIC__/grf/1a.grf", "__STATIC__/data/DataCenter.php?data=Student", true, ""); </script>###3. コントローラー コードを記述します###
public function DisplayViewReport() { return $this->fetch(); }###4. データベース接続コードを変更します######Data ディレクトリの mysql_GenXmlData.php ファイルで、独自のデータベース サーバー条件に従って mysql_connect() を入力し、mysql_select_db() に独自のデータベース名を記述します。 ######### これは最も単純な統合ケースであり、複数テーブルのクエリは含まれていません。単純なものから始めれば、複雑なものも徐々にシンプルになっていきます。 #########
以上がThinkphp5 統合 Grid++ レポートの詳細説明の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。